New Photo of Sinead O'Connor Fuels Online Surprise
The "Nothing Compares 2 U" singer is unrecognizable while performing at an Irish music festival over the weekend.
A new image featuring an unrecognizable Sinead O'Connor took the Internet by surprise Monday.
The photo, first posted by People.com, shows the singer sporting a much different look than in her early 1990s heyday.
While performing as a backup singer at a summer music festival in Ireland over the weekend, a noticeably heftier O'Connor donned a belly-baring tank top along with a black hairstyle featuring choppy bangs.
It's quite a different look from her "Nothing Compares 2 U" days, during which the then-trim singer sported a shaved head.

O'Connor broke out with her album I Do Not Want What I Haven't Got in 1990, featuring a cover of "Nothing" originally recorded by Prince's side project The Family. It earned her a Grammy for best alternative music performance.
In 1992, she generated headlines after infamously reipping up a picture of Pope John Paul II on Saturday Night Live to protest sexual abuse in the Roman Catholic Church.
O'Connor, who is on tour in Europe, was singing backup for reggae artist Natty Wailer at the Bray Seaside Festival. She released her most recent album, Throw Down Your Arms, in 2005.
